Understanding Cross Platform Gaming
Before delving into the question of “Is Dying Light 2 cross platform”, it is crucial to grasp the concept of cross platform gaming. In the gaming world, cross platform gaming refers to the ability to play a game on various gaming systems, such as Xbox, PlayStation, PC, and even mobile devices. When a game is labeled as cross platform, it signifies that players using different devices can collaborate and embark on adventures together, essentially breaking down the barriers that traditionally separated these gaming platforms.
